Output fa7851bdaab23c9098d43f10db74f3d07ef0d2a12ba31f837db37df99a5b7030:29

value
18254318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c237c296f679b70436309607ab7e7e5c1d4ac4 OP_EQUAL
address
3FAHvEUDJB1m4mZDmS5cFxYGu6wpiXCM9g
transaction
fa7851bdaab23c9098d43f10db74f3d07ef0d2a12ba31f837db37df99a5b7030
spent
true